We are a research-driven cybersecurity technology company founded in Switzerland and expanded across Cyprus and Greece, delivering comprehensive solutions for cyber risk management.
This EC Project Manager role involves managing and supervising EU or National funded research and innovation projects. Responsibilities include representing the company in R&D projects, managing stakeholder relationships, defining specifications, ensuring project feasibility and resource availability, and managing budget and risk. The role requires strong communication, leadership, and problem-solving skills.
We are a research-driven cybersecurity technology company founded in Switzerland and expanded across Cyprus and Greece, delivering comprehensive solutions for cyber risk management.